To quickly access health information from your website's browser, download Don’t Panic! Hi, I’m a 46yrs young, and while I have had about 4 bouts with pericarditis within the past 4 yrs. I think I have managed to not panic the last 3 times. The first time I was suddenly struck with this condition, I thought I was having a heart attack and went through all the tests, which I highly recommend! Once I had gone through everything my professional Physicain recommended, somehow the preceeding episodes became somewhat milder. I am in good health, run at least 4-5 times a week about 4 miles. I eat healthy foods and don’t drink alcohol nor do I smoke. Hang in there and Try not to panic if this happens to you! Comments
